#

Как создать сюжетную линию и диалоговые сцены в играх

Редакция rating-gamedev

Чтение: 4 минуты

1 593

Сюжет и диалоги игры - важнейшие компоненты, которые могут сделать игровой опыт незабываемым и захватывающим.

Как создать сюжетную линию и диалоговые сцены в играх

Создание увлекательных и захватывающих игр требует не только технических навыков, но и мастерства в создании привлекательной сюжетной линии и диалоговых сцен. Игроки ожидают глубокой сюжетности, реалистичных персонажей и интересных диалогов, которые погрузят их в уникальный игровой мир. В этой статье мы рассмотрим несколько важных принципов создания сюжетной линии и диалоговых сцен, которые помогут вам сделать вашу игру незабываемой.

1. Определите основную концепцию игры и жанр

Перед тем, как приступать к созданию сюжетной линии и диалоговых сцен, необходимо определить основную концепцию игры и ее жанр. Например, если ваша игра является фантастическим приключением, сюжетная линия должна быть насыщена фантастическими элементами, а диалоги должны подчеркивать эту атмосферу. Работа над сюжетом и диалогами должна быть согласована с основной концепцией игры, чтобы создать единое и цельное впечатление.

2. Создайте интересных персонажей

Хорошие персонажи способны оживить игровой мир и заинтересовать игроков. Каждый персонаж должен иметь свою индивидуальность, характерные черты и мотивацию. Разнообразие персонажей в игре поможет создать насыщенную и разностороннюю сюжетную линию и диалоги.

При создании персонажей вы должны учитывать их роль в игре и их взаимодействие с игроком. Каждый персонаж должен иметь уникальный голос, стиль речи и манеру поведения. Сильные персонажи с интересными диалогами помогут игрокам лучше погрузиться в игровой мир и ощутить его атмосферу.

3. Структурируйте сюжетную линию

Сюжетная линия игры должна быть хорошо структурирована и последовательна. Определите основной конфликт и цель главного героя, а затем разбейте сюжет на логические эпизоды. Каждый эпизод должен иметь свою собственную мини-структуру с вступлением, развитием и разрешением. Это поможет поддерживать интерес игроков и держать их в напряжении до самого конца игры.

4. Пишите естественные и реалистичные диалоги

Диалоги в игре должны быть естественными и реалистичными, чтобы игроки могли легко воспринимать информацию и сопереживать персонажам. Избегайте излишней формальности и излишней расширенности речи. Диалоги должны быть четкими, короткими и в точности передавать эмоции и мотивацию персонажей.

Кроме того, уделите внимание уникальному стилю речи каждого персонажа. Ментальность, социальный статус и личные черты каждого персонажа должны быть отражены в его диалогах. Это поможет создать глубокие и запоминающиеся диалоговые сцены.

5. Используйте нелинейные сюжетные развития

Использование нелинейных сюжетных развитий позволит игрокам влиять на ход событий и создать свою собственную индивидуальную историю. Предоставьте игрокам выбор и последствия их решений, чтобы они ощущали себя вовлеченными в происходящее.

Нелинейность в сюжете и диалогах может быть достигнута путем введения альтернативных концовок, различных миссий и квестов, а также вариантов ответов в диалогах. Это позволит игрокам испытывать разные эмоции и переживания в процессе игры.

Заключение

Создание увлекательной сюжетной линии и диалоговых сцен – это важная часть разработки игр. Она требует творчества и внимания к деталям, чтобы создать незабываемый игровой опыт для игроков. Учтите основные принципы, которые были описаны в этой статье, и ваша игра станет настоящим шедевром с увлекательным сюжетом и живыми персонажами.

Способность создавать увлекательные сюжетные линии и диалоговые сцены в играх заключается в умении затягивать игрока в свой мир и заставлять его эмоционально взаимодействовать с персонажами и их историями.Дэвид Кейдж
Название игрыЖанрСюжетная линия
Ведьмак 3: Дикая ОхотаРолевая игра, экшенСюжетная линия рассказывает о приключениях героя Геральта из Ривии, профессионального охотника за чудовищами.
Life is StrangeПриключение, интерактивный квестИгра представляет собой историю об обычной школьнице по имени Макс, которая обнаруживает способность перемещаться во времени.
The Last of UsХоррор, экшен, приключениеСюжетная линия рассказывает о жизни Джоэла и Элли после начала эпидемии грибка-паразита, превращающего людей в инфицированных смертоносных монстров.

Основные проблемы по теме "Как создать сюжетную линию и диалоговые сцены в играх"

1. Неинтересный или запутанный сюжет

Одной из основных проблем при создании сюжетной линии и диалоговых сцен в играх является неспособность заинтересовать игрока или создать понятную и логичную историю. Неудачный сюжет может привести к отсутствию мотивации у игрока продолжать играть или к непониманию происходящего. Запутанный сюжет, в свою очередь, может вызывать путаницу и затруднять понимание и переживание сюжетных событий.

2. Неубедительные диалоги и персонажи

Другой проблемой является создание неубедительных диалогов и персонажей. Диалоги должны звучать естественно и передавать индивидуальные черты каждого персонажа. Если диалоги звучат неестественно или персонажи неубедительны, игроки могут потерять интерес к сюжету и диалогам, а также испытывать сложности в сопереживании и понимании их мотиваций и целей.

3. Отсутствие персонализации и влияния на сюжет

Некоторые игроки ожидают, что их действия будут иметь влияние на сюжет и развитие истории. Однако, в некоторых играх отсутствует возможность персонализировать сюжет или принимать решения, влияющие на его развитие. Это может вызывать недовольство у игроков и снижать их вовлеченность в игру. Поэтому важно создавать механики, которые позволяют игрокам влиять на сюжет и видеть результаты своих действий.

Какие основные технологические аспекты в разработке веб-приложений?

Основные технологические аспекты в разработке веб-приложений включают:

  • Выбор языка программирования: например, JavaScript, Python, PHP.
  • Использование фреймворков: например, Angular, React, Laravel.
  • Управление базами данных: например, MySQL, MongoDB, PostgreSQL.
  • Развертывание приложений: например, на серверах с использованием Docker или в облачных платформах, таких как AWS или Azure.
  • Обеспечение безопасности: например, шифрование данных, аутентификация, контроль доступа.
Какие платформы используются для разработки мобильных приложений?

Для разработки мобильных приложений можно использовать следующие платформы:

  • Android: основная платформа для разработки на языке Java или Kotlin.
  • iOS: платформа для разработки на языках Objective-C или Swift.
  • React Native: фреймворк, позволяющий разрабатывать мобильные приложения с использованием JavaScript и React.
  • Xamarin: платформа, использующая язык программирования C# и позволяющая создавать приложения для Android и iOS.
Какие технологические аспекты важны при разработке и развертывании искусственного интеллекта?

При разработке и развертывании искусственного интеллекта важны следующие технологические аспекты:

  • Сбор и предварительная обработка данных: сбор и очистка данных для обучения модели искусственного интеллекта.
  • Выбор и обучение модели: выбор наиболее подходящей модели искусственного интеллекта и ее обучение на тренировочных данных.
  • Интеграция и развертывание: интеграция модели искусственного интеллекта в приложение или систему, а также развертывание на определенной платформе или в облаке.
  • Мониторинг и оптимизация: постоянный мониторинг работы модели искусственного интеллекта, оптимизация ее работы и обновление при необходимости.